Understanding HOA Landscaping Essentials
Before diving into specific maintenance techniques, it’s important to grasp the core elements that make up successful HOA landscaping. These essentials form the foundation for a thriving, sustainable, and visually appealing community landscape.
Plant Selection: Choose native and drought-resistant plants to reduce water usage and maintenance costs.
Irrigation Systems: Implement efficient irrigation that targets plant roots and minimizes water waste.
Seasonal Planning: Schedule planting, pruning, and fertilizing according to seasonal needs.
Community Standards: Align landscaping choices with HOA guidelines to maintain uniformity and curb appeal.
Sustainability Practices: Incorporate eco-friendly methods such as composting and integrated pest management.
By focusing on these essentials, your HOA can create a landscape that not only looks great but also supports environmental health and reduces long-term expenses.

Practical Steps to Upgrade Your HOA Landscape Maintenance
Transforming your HOA landscape maintenance involves more than just regular mowing and watering. It requires a strategic approach that balances aesthetics, functionality, and sustainability. Here are actionable steps to get started:
Conduct a Landscape Audit
Begin by assessing the current state of your community’s landscape. Identify problem areas such as overgrown shrubs, dead plants, or inefficient irrigation zones. This audit will help prioritize improvements.
Develop a Maintenance Schedule
Create a detailed calendar that outlines tasks like mowing, fertilizing, pruning, and pest control. Consistency is key to keeping the landscape healthy and attractive.
Invest in Quality Equipment and Training
Ensure your maintenance team has access to modern tools and training on best practices. Proper equipment reduces labor time and improves results.
Engage Residents in Beautification Projects
Encourage community involvement through planting days or garden clubs. Resident participation fosters pride and helps maintain common areas.
Monitor and Adjust Irrigation
Regularly check irrigation systems for leaks or blockages. Adjust watering schedules based on weather conditions to conserve water.
Implement Sustainable Practices
Use organic fertilizers, mulch beds to retain moisture, and introduce beneficial insects to control pests naturally.
By following these steps, your HOA can significantly improve the health and appearance of its outdoor spaces.

Enhancing Curb Appeal with Thoughtful Design
Curb appeal is a critical factor in the overall satisfaction of HOA residents and the value of the community. Thoughtful landscape design can transform ordinary spaces into stunning outdoor environments.
Create Focal Points: Use features like flower beds, sculptures, or water elements to draw attention and add interest.
Incorporate Pathways: Well-designed walkways improve accessibility and encourage residents to enjoy outdoor areas.
Use Color Wisely: Select plants with varying bloom times and colors to ensure year-round visual appeal.
Balance Hardscape and Softscape: Combine natural elements like trees and shrubs with hardscape features such as benches and retaining walls.
Lighting: Install landscape lighting to enhance safety and highlight key features during evening hours.
These design principles help create a welcoming atmosphere that residents will appreciate and visitors will admire.
Leveraging Technology for Smarter Maintenance
Modern technology offers numerous tools to streamline and improve HOA landscape maintenance. Integrating these innovations can save time, reduce costs, and enhance results.
Smart Irrigation Controllers: These devices adjust watering schedules based on weather data and soil moisture levels.
Drones for Inspection: Use drones to survey large areas quickly and identify issues like pest infestations or irrigation problems.
Landscape Management Software: Track maintenance schedules, budgets, and vendor performance in one centralized platform.
Soil Sensors: Monitor soil health and moisture to optimize watering and fertilization.
Automated Mowers: Robotic mowers can maintain lawns efficiently, especially in large common areas.
Adopting technology not only improves maintenance efficiency but also supports sustainable landscaping practices.
Building a Long-Term Landscape Maintenance Plan
Sustainability and consistency are vital for the long-term success of your HOA’s landscape. Developing a comprehensive maintenance plan ensures that improvements are preserved and enhanced over time.
Set Clear Goals: Define what you want to achieve with your landscape, such as increased biodiversity, reduced water use, or enhanced aesthetics.
Budget Wisely: Allocate funds for routine maintenance, emergency repairs, and future upgrades.
Hire Qualified Professionals: Work with experienced landscapers who understand HOA requirements and local climate conditions.
Regularly Review and Update Plans: Landscape needs evolve, so revisit your plan annually to incorporate new trends and technologies.
Educate Residents: Provide information on how residents can contribute to maintaining the landscape, such as proper disposal of yard waste or reporting issues promptly.
A well-structured plan helps your HOA maintain a beautiful and functional landscape that benefits everyone.
